Goldman Sachs, founded in 1869 by Marcus Goldman and later joined by Samuel Sachs, is a premier global investment bank headquartered in New York City, renowned for its influential role in financial markets. The firm provides a wide range of services, including investment banking (mergers, acquisitions, and underwriting), securities trading, asset management, and consumer banking through its Marcus platform,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. Known for its elite status on Wall Street, Goldman Sachs has a history of navigating major economic events, from the Great Depression to the 2008 financial crisis, where it played a controversial yet pivotal role. With a strong emphasis on innovation and a global footprint, it manages billions in assets and remains a powerhouse in shaping economic policy and market trends.

Goldman Sachs's Q2 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2019, Goldman Sachs held 5,555 positions worth $347B, up 5% from $331B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 14% of the portfolio.

Goldman Sachs's Q2 2019 filing shows 479 new, 1,984 increased, 2,332 reduced and 460 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Uber: 70,291,715 shares worth $3.26B. The largest sale was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$1.15B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 13% of assets, up from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
